FREE In-Person Training Opportunity in North Carolina

  Best Practices for Addressing  Homelessness and Migrant Issues  

Better Outcomes Through Collaboration

          Fire Service – Code Enforcement – Emergency Management – Public Health - Homeless Services - Nonprofits

Practical, dignified solutions that protect first responders, reduce risk, and save lives—through coordinated, community-based action. 

In-Person Workshop - North Carolina

This 6-hour in-person training blends lecture and hands-on workshop activities, with opportunities to network and connect first responders with local partners and resources. You also receive a student workbook and have opportunities to become a field trainer.

In cooperation with the North Carolina State Fire Marshal’s Office and the North Carolina Association of Fire Chiefs
